ANSER is seeking an experienced staff action officer to serve as an Industry Engagement Analyst supporting an Office of the Secretary of Defense (OSD) client at the Pentagon in Arlington, VA. In this key role, you will assist the client in interacting with industry partners.
This position does not offer remote or hybrid work options with all job duties performed full-time onsite at the Pentagon.
Day to Day Responsibilities:
• Provide administrative, logistical, and analytical support for the vetting, prioritization, planning, and execution of industry engagements, including the development of plans of actions and milestones, invitations, agendas, senior leader talking points, briefings and information papers, attendance rosters, meeting summaries, and tracking actions.
• Coordinate with internal and external Department of Defense (DoD) stakeholders on all aspects of engagements meetings, including read-ahead development and distribution and Pentagon visitor protocols.
• Track and analyze issues and priorities across engagements and coordinate progress with internal and external POCs.
• Develop and maintain standard operating procedures in accordance with DoD-level requirements.
• Track metrics and develop methods for improving industry engagement processes and outcomes.
• Maintain forum SharePoint sites and other collaboration tools.
• Provide similar support to other engagement efforts, e.g., with stakeholders in academia or with international partners, on an as needed basis.
• Take ownership of assigned tasks and projects and ensure timely delivery.
Required Qualifications:
• Possess an active TS/SCI security clearance
• Bachelor’s degree in a event planning, project management, business administration, government or other related field
• 10+ years of professional experience or a high school diploma with 14+ years of professional experience
• Experience coordinating events and / or meetings.
• Experience supporting GO/FO/SES clients or similar senior leaders.
• Experience developing and coordinating tasks in CATMS or similar task management and / or planning tools.
• High proficiency in Microsoft Office Software.
Preferred Qualifications:
• Prior experience supporting clients at the OSD level.
• Excellent organizational and communication skills and attention to detail.
• Ability to take initiative, prioritize, plan, and execute with limited oversight in a fast-paced environment.
